Title: Innovations of Kiyoshi Kagehira in Continuous Casting Technology

Introduction

Kiyoshi Kagehira, an innovative inventor based in Hiroshima, Japan, has made significant contributions to the field of metallurgical engineering. With two patents to his name, Kagehira has played a crucial role in advancing continuous casting technology, particularly in the efficient casting of molten steel. His work is primarily associated with Mitsubishi-Hitachi Metals Machinery, Inc., where he collaborates with fellow inventor Tatsunori Sugimoto to enhance casting processes.

Latest Patents

Kiyoshi Kagehira holds two notable patents that showcase his expertise in twin-roll continuous casting.

1. **Twin-roll Continuous Caster**: This invention is configured to efficiently cast molten steel by utilizing cooling rolls. The design incorporates ridges on the surfaces of the cooling rolls, which facilitate the generation of solidified shell edges through the pressing and bonding of lateral edges. This efficient technique results in the formation of both cast-piece edges and a central portion containing unsolidified molten steel, optimizing the casting process.

2. **Twin-roll Continuous Casting Machine and Rolling Equipment**: Kagehira's second patent pertains to a twin-roll continuous casting machine that features an innovative moving mechanism for facilitating the relative movement of the rolls. This design includes upper and lower side support rolls that provide enhanced support for the cast slab during transportation, ensuring that the upper surface serves as a reliable reference surface throughout the casting process.
